tailor / sewer What's the difference? And what word is more appropriate if in general conversation we want to mention people who simply sew clothes?

Sewer is just someone that sews. A tailor specifically makes clothes. Additionally sewer means: An artificial, usually underground conduit for carrying off sewage or rainwater. The word sewer is most commonly known for this definition. So using the word tailor would be easier to understand.
